Salisbury,PA : Man seriously injured in I-78 crash dies, passenger critical on September, Friday 22th 2017

Authorities say one of two people seriously injured when their car crashed into a tractor trailer on Interstate 78 has died.

The Lehigh County coroner tells WFMZ-TV (http://bit.ly/2fg1WCB ) that 25-year-old Christopher Williams, of Colmar, died at a hospital shortly after 3:30 p.m. Friday. Williams’ passenger, 22-year-old Edmund Thomas, of Churchville, is in critical condition at a hospital.

Pennsylvania State Police say Williams’ car struck the rear of a tractor trailer that had broken down along the eastbound shoulder of I-78 in Greenwich Township just before 6 p.m. Wednesday. The driver of the tractor trailer wasn’t injured.
